Jak v\u00fdkonn\u00fd by m\u011bl b\u00fdt <a href=\"https:\/\/www.heiwit.com\/cs\/jak-vypada-solarni-panel-a-jak-funguje\/\" title=\"\">sol\u00e1rn\u00ed panely<\/a> uspokojit popt\u00e1vku va\u0161\u00ed spole\u010dnosti po energii<\/strong>?<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Dimenzov\u00e1n\u00ed fotovoltaick\u00fdch za\u0159\u00edzen\u00ed nen\u00ed jen ot\u00e1zkou v\u00fdpo\u010dtu v\u00fdkonu na z\u00e1klad\u011b spot\u0159eby energie, ale zahrnuje tak\u00e9 p\u0159esn\u00e9 posouzen\u00ed faktor\u016f \u017eivotn\u00edho prost\u0159ed\u00ed, zem\u011bpisn\u00e9 polohy, vlastnost\u00ed za\u0159\u00edzen\u00ed a specifick\u00fdch po\u017eadavk\u016f z\u00e1kazn\u00edka. Pouze na z\u00e1klad\u011b podrobn\u00e9 a metodick\u00e9 anal\u00fdzy lze zaru\u010dit \u00fa\u010dinnost, spolehlivost a \u017eivotnost fotovoltaick\u00e9ho syst\u00e9mu.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">V tomto \u010dl\u00e1nku se budeme zab\u00fdvat <strong>z\u00e1kladn\u00ed principy dimenzov\u00e1n\u00ed fotovoltaick\u00fdch za\u0159\u00edzen\u00ed, anal\u00fdza prom\u011bnn\u00fdch, kter\u00e9 je t\u0159eba vz\u00edt v \u00favahu, a metody pou\u017e\u00edvan\u00e9 pro stanoven\u00ed po\u017eadovan\u00e9ho v\u00fdkonu.<\/strong>.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Jak\u00e9 aspekty je t\u0159eba zv\u00e1\u017eit p\u0159ed instalac\u00ed fotovoltaick\u00e9ho syst\u00e9mu na st\u0159echu firmy<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">P\u0159ed instalac\u00ed fotovoltaick\u00e9ho syst\u00e9mu na st\u0159echu firmy je nutn\u00e9 zv\u00e1\u017eit n\u011bkolik kl\u00ed\u010dov\u00fdch aspekt\u016f, kter\u00e9 zajist\u00ed efektivn\u00ed a ziskovou realizaci. Zde je praktick\u00fd kontroln\u00ed seznam: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Anal\u00fdza pr\u016fm\u011brn\u00e9 energetick\u00e9 n\u00e1ro\u010dnosti spole\u010dnosti<\/strong> je z\u00e1sadn\u00ed. To zahrnuje vyhodnocen\u00ed spot\u0159eby energie v kilowatthodin\u00e1ch (kWh) v pr\u016fb\u011bhu \u010dasu, kter\u00e9 se z\u00edsk\u00e1 nahl\u00e9dnut\u00edm do minul\u00fdch \u00fa\u010dt\u016f za energii. Pro v\u00fdpo\u010det energetick\u00e9 pot\u0159eby podniku vyn\u00e1sobte v\u00fdkon spot\u0159ebi\u010d\u016f v kilowattech dobou pou\u017e\u00edv\u00e1n\u00ed. Nap\u0159\u00edklad klimatizace o v\u00fdkonu 2 kW po dobu 5 hodin spot\u0159ebuje 10 kWh. Pro odhad ro\u010dn\u00ed spot\u0159eby spole\u010dnosti vezm\u011bte v \u00favahu r\u016fzn\u00e9 pou\u017e\u00edvan\u00e9 spot\u0159ebi\u010de. <\/li>\n\n\n\n<li>Klimatick\u00e9 podm\u00ednky a slune\u010dn\u00ed z\u00e1\u0159en\u00ed v oblasti, kde se spole\u010dnost nach\u00e1z\u00ed, p\u0159\u00edmo ovliv\u0148uj\u00ed v\u00fdrobu sol\u00e1rn\u00ed energie.<strong> Je d\u016fle\u017eit\u00e9 pe\u010dliv\u011b vyhodnotit tyto prom\u011bnn\u00e9, aby bylo mo\u017en\u00e9 ur\u010dit, kolik sol\u00e1rn\u00ed energie by syst\u00e9m mohl vyrobit.<\/strong><\/li>\n\n\n\n<li>La <a href=\"https:\/\/www.heiwit.com\/cs\/pruvodce-typy-solarnich-panelu-jak-si-vybrat-ten-nejlepsi\/\" title=\"\">v\u00fdb\u011br nej\u00fa\u010dinn\u011bj\u0161\u00edch sol\u00e1rn\u00edch panel\u016f<\/a> m\u00e1 z\u00e1sadn\u00ed v\u00fdznam pro maximalizaci v\u00fdroby energie. M\u011bly by b\u00fdt zva\u017eov\u00e1ny panely s vysokou \u00fa\u010dinnost\u00ed p\u0159em\u011bny, kter\u00e9 jsou schopny zajistit optim\u00e1ln\u00ed v\u00fdkon i v m\u011bn\u00edc\u00edch se podm\u00ednk\u00e1ch prost\u0159ed\u00ed.<\/li>\n\n\n\n<li><strong>Je t\u0159eba zvolit velikost a v\u00fdkon sol\u00e1rn\u00edch panel\u016f.<a href=\"https:\/\/www.heiwit.com\/cs\/instalace-fotovoltaickych-panelu-pozadavky-na-strechu\/\" title=\"\"> v z\u00e1vislosti na velikosti st\u0159echy spole\u010dnosti a dostupnosti prostoru.<\/a>.<\/strong> Krom\u011b toho je d\u016fle\u017eit\u00e9 posoudit celkov\u00fd v\u00fdkon pot\u0159ebn\u00fd k uspokojen\u00ed energetick\u00fdch pot\u0159eb spole\u010dnosti.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Pro\u010d je d\u016fle\u017eit\u00e9 zvolit spr\u00e1vn\u00fd v\u00fdkon a velikost sol\u00e1rn\u00edho syst\u00e9mu?<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Volba spr\u00e1vn\u00e9ho v\u00fdkonu a velikosti sol\u00e1rn\u00edho syst\u00e9mu m\u00e1 z\u00e1sadn\u00ed v\u00fdznam pro zaji\u0161t\u011bn\u00ed optim\u00e1ln\u00ed \u00fa\u010dinnosti a maximalizaci energetick\u00fdch v\u00fdnos\u016f. Jen tak m\u016f\u017ee m\u00edt va\u0161e spole\u010dnost <a href=\"https:\/\/www.heiwit.com\/cs\/mene-co2-diky-fotovoltaickemu-systemu-na-strese-firmy\/\" title=\"\">sn\u00ed\u017een\u00ed dopadu na \u017eivotn\u00ed prost\u0159ed\u00ed<\/a> a m\u016f\u017eete <a href=\"https:\/\/www.heiwit.com\/cs\/kolik-muzete-usetrit-s-fotovoltaikou\/\" title=\"\">\u00faspora na \u00fa\u010dtech<\/a>. <\/p>\n\n\n\n<p class=\"wp-block-paragraph\">V\u00fdkon sol\u00e1rn\u00edch panel\u016f se m\u016f\u017ee v\u00fdrazn\u011b li\u0161it, a to od p\u0159ibli\u017en\u011b 150 W do 370 W na panel v z\u00e1vislosti na \u00fa\u010dinnosti panelu a technologii \u010dl\u00e1nk\u016f. Nap\u0159\u00edklad vysoce kvalitn\u00ed sol\u00e1rn\u00ed \u010dl\u00e1nky mohou absorbovat v\u00edce slune\u010dn\u00edho sv\u011btla a poskytovat vy\u0161\u0161\u00ed \u00fa\u010dinnost p\u0159em\u011bny. <strong>V\u00fdsledkem je vy\u0161\u0161\u00ed produkce energie a vy\u0161\u0161\u00ed trvanlivost d\u00edky odolnosti proti delaminaci.<\/strong>.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">V\u00fdkon fotovoltaick\u00e9ho panelu vyj\u00e1d\u0159en\u00fd v kWp (kilowatt peak) p\u0159edstavuje maxim\u00e1ln\u00ed okam\u017eit\u00fd elektrick\u00fd v\u00fdkon vyroben\u00fd za ide\u00e1ln\u00edch podm\u00ednek. \u00da\u010dinnost panelu, vypo\u010dten\u00e1 v procentech, ud\u00e1v\u00e1 mno\u017estv\u00ed slune\u010dn\u00ed energie p\u0159em\u011bn\u011bn\u00e9 na elekt\u0159inu na jednotku plochy. Nap\u0159\u00edklad 250 Wp panel s \u00fa\u010dinnost\u00ed 15,15% p\u0159em\u011bn\u00ed za ide\u00e1ln\u00edch podm\u00ednek 15,15% slune\u010dn\u00edho z\u00e1\u0159en\u00ed na elektrickou energii.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Dal\u0161\u00edm d\u016fle\u017eit\u00fdm aspektem je velikost sol\u00e1rn\u00edch panel\u016f. <strong>Typick\u00e9 rozm\u011bry sol\u00e1rn\u00edch panel\u016f pro obytn\u00e9 budovy se pohybuj\u00ed kolem 65 \u00d7 39 palc\u016f, ale u r\u016fzn\u00fdch v\u00fdrobc\u016f se mohou m\u00edrn\u011b li\u0161it.<\/strong>. Je nezbytn\u00e9 pe\u010dliv\u011b posoudit dostupnost st\u0159e\u0161n\u00edho prostoru a zvolit vhodnou velikost panel\u016f, aby se maximalizovala \u00fa\u010dinnost a vyu\u017eit\u00ed dostupn\u00e9 plochy.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Pro ro\u010dn\u00ed spot\u0159ebu 3000 kWh sta\u010d\u00ed syst\u00e9m o v\u00fdkonu 3 kW, pro spot\u0159ebu 4000 a\u017e 6000 kWh je pot\u0159eba syst\u00e9m o v\u00fdkonu 4,5 kW.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Krom\u011b toho, <strong>hmotnost sol\u00e1rn\u00edch panel\u016f je rozhoduj\u00edc\u00edm faktorem, kter\u00fd je t\u0159eba vz\u00edt v \u00favahu, aby byla zaji\u0161t\u011bna konstruk\u010dn\u00ed bezpe\u010dnost st\u0159echy.<\/strong>. A\u010dkoli se hmotnost panel\u016f m\u016f\u017ee u r\u016fzn\u00fdch zna\u010dek m\u00edrn\u011b li\u0161it, v\u011bt\u0161ina sol\u00e1rn\u00edch panel\u016f v\u00e1\u017e\u00ed kolem 20 kg.
